Introduction

Boksburg, located in the Gauteng province of South Africa, is a city known for its rich industrial heritage and vibrant community life. As part of the East Rand region, Boksburg has grown from a mining town into a bustling urban center with a diverse economy.

The city is characterized by its blend of historical charm and modern amenities, offering residents and visitors a unique experience. Boksburg's strategic location near Johannesburg makes it an attractive destination for business and leisure, with a variety of shopping centers, parks, and cultural venues.

History and Culture

Boksburg was established in 1887 following the discovery of gold in the region, which led to rapid development and the establishment of infrastructure to support mining activities. The city played a significant role during the gold rush era, contributing to the economic growth of South Africa.

Over the years, Boksburg has evolved into a culturally diverse city, with influences from various ethnic communities enriching its cultural landscape. The city is home to several historical landmarks, including the Boksburg Lake and the Old Post Office, which reflect its rich past.

Cultural institutions such as the Boksburg Civic Centre and various local theaters provide platforms for artistic expression and community engagement. The city's cultural calendar is filled with events and festivals that celebrate its diversity, including music concerts, art exhibitions, and traditional dance performances.

Things to do in Boksburg

Visitors to Boksburg can enjoy a variety of activities, from exploring the scenic Boksburg Lake to shopping at the East Rand Mall, one of the largest malls in the region. The lake offers opportunities for picnicking, boating, and bird watching, making it a popular spot for families and nature enthusiasts.

For those interested in history, the Boksburg Historical Museum provides insights into the city's past, showcasing artifacts and exhibits related to its mining heritage. The museum is a must-visit for anyone looking to understand the roots of Boksburg.

Boksburg also boasts a vibrant dining scene, with numerous restaurants offering a range of cuisines from traditional South African dishes to international flavors. The city's nightlife is lively, with various bars and clubs providing entertainment for locals and tourists alike.

Weather in Boksburg

Boksburg, South Africa experiences a subtropical highland climate characterized by warm, rainy summers and mild, dry winters. The city receives an average annual precipitation of approximately 28 inches (700 mm), with January being the wettest month, averaging around 5 inches (125 mm) of rainfall.

Seasonal Breakdown
  • Spring (September to November)Temperatures gradually rise from an average high of 72°F (22°C) in September to 79°F (26°C) in November. Rainfall begins to increase during this period, with November receiving significant precipitation, averaging around 3.5 inches (90 mm).
  • Summer (December to February)The hottest months, with average highs ranging from 81°F (27°C) in December to 84°F (29°C) in January. Rainfall is at its peak during the summer, with January being the wettest month, averaging around 5 inches (125 mm) of rainfall.
  • Autumn (March to May)Temperatures gradually decrease from an average high of 79°F (26°C) in March to 70°F (21°C) in May. Rainfall decreases during this period, with May being relatively dry, averaging around 1.5 inches (40 mm).
  • Winter (June to August)The coldest period, with average highs ranging from 64°F (18°C) in June to 67°F (19°C) in August. Rainfall is minimal, with July being the driest month, averaging about 0.5 inches (13 mm).
Notable Weather Events
  • Summer thunderstorms are common, often accompanied by heavy rain and occasional hail.
  • Heatwaves can occur during the peak of summer, with temperatures occasionally exceeding 90°F (32°C).
  • Frost is rare but can occur during the winter months, particularly in July.

Boksburg's Political Climate

African National Congress (ANC)

Boksburg, located in South Africa, is a city with a dynamic political climate that reflects the broader national trends. The city is governed under the framework of the Ekurhuleni Metropolitan Municipality, which is known for its diverse political representation. The African National Congress (ANC) has historically been a dominant force in the region, although recent years have seen increased competition from other parties such as the Democratic Alliance (DA) and the Economic Freedom Fighters (EFF).

Boksburg's political history is deeply intertwined with South Africa's journey through apartheid and into democracy. The city has been a site of significant political activism and transformation. Currently, the political leadership in Boksburg is focused on addressing issues such as economic inequality, infrastructure development, and service delivery. The city has also been at the forefront of implementing progressive policies, particularly in areas like renewable energy and urban development.

The political climate in Boksburg significantly influences its economic and social policies. The city has been proactive in promoting economic growth through initiatives aimed at supporting small businesses and attracting foreign investment. Socially, there is a strong emphasis on improving education and healthcare services, reflecting the city's commitment to enhancing the quality of life for its residents.

Recent political trends in Boksburg include a growing emphasis on transparency and accountability in governance. This has been driven by both public demand and political necessity, as residents increasingly call for more effective and responsive leadership. Additionally, local movements advocating for social justice and environmental sustainability have gained momentum, shaping the city's policy directions.
